- www.hypeplustv.com/ - Rachel True is easily a recognized face in Hollywood after she would appear in films like Half Baked, CB4, Craft, and hit series Half & Half. In this episode of Unforgotten, we explore what the actress has been up to and why people may have started seeing her less on screen. Symphony Thompson reports.
